Union Village Ltd. Announces New Early American Furniture Line

Early American Furniture arranged in tasteful room-like settings is now available for viewing and ordering at Union Village Ltd., The Colonial Furniture Store located in Greenwich, New York.

Greenwich, NY, October 05, 2005 --(PR.com)-- Union Village Ltd. (http://www.unionvillageltd.com) the leading early American Furniture Store in New York and Vermont has added new lines of early American Reproduction Furniture for customers seeking to decorate their home in colonial style.

“Our research has shown many home owners would like to decorate their homes in early American style. Home owners can now visit our store and view early American reproduction furnishings in room-like settings prior to ordering. This helps them visualize how the furnishings would look in their own home.” Judy Flagg – Owner.

A full range of early American Reproduction Furniture (http://www.unionvillageltd.com/early-american-furniture) has been arranged in room-like settings to allow visitors to view early American style furnishings as they stroll through the store.

Hoosier Cabinets (http://www.unionvillageltd.com/early-american-furniture/hoosier-cabinets.cfm)
Reproduction Hoosier Cabinets are offered by Union Village Ltd. in several different paint colors or stains. Hoosier style cabinets were first manufactured in the Hoosier state, Indiana, and were widely popular in American kitchens from 1900-the 1930s.
